What if it becomes a bigger company where different servers and data storage are used for different departments? Several servers can be controlled by one station using a KVM switch. If there are 4 or maybe 8 servers that a person needs to check or maintain, he can just stay at one console which has a keyboard, video monitor and mouse connected to the KVM switch. Each of the servers connected to the switch can be accessed instead of going to each of the servers to access and maintain them. It would save time and effort and if any problem occurs with one of the servers, he would not need to go to the server directly but instead access it from his station. It would be like he is accessing the servers from a network but it is a network not accessible by other computers since it is a direct connection to the servers.
